about this event

Kit Harington (Game of  Thrones) plays the title role in Shakespeare’s thrilling study of  nationalism, war and the psychology of power.

Fresh to the throne, King Henry V launches England into a bloody war  with France. When his campaign encounters resistance, this inexperienced  new ruler must prove he is fit to guide a country into war.

Captured live from the Donmar Warehouse in London, this exciting  modern production directed by Max Webster (Life of Pi) explores what it  means to be English and our relationship to Europe, asking: do we ever  get the leaders we deserve?
